Rossoneri can keep Lecce out

AC Milan are winning machine at the moment and should take care of business at home to struggling Lecce on Saturday with a clean sheet into the bargain.

Stefano Pioli’s men have won six successive games in all competitions and are unbeaten in their last nine home league matches, seven of which were won.

The Rossoneri have caught fire this spring with several players finding their form. Rafael Leao, who has scored six goals in his last ten appearances for club and country, is a constant menace and Christian Pulisic has been just as impressive with four goals in his last five Milan matches.

Inefficient Lecce look there for the taking 

Lecce, who remain four points above the relegation line after a 0-0 draw against Roma last weekend, have been trying to defend their way to salvation.

Only two clubs have scored fewer goals than them in Serie A this season but they have taken the fifth-most shots, which must make them the most inefficient team in the top flight.

Milan have the ability to dominate possession and make them suffer in this clash with a win to nil backable at the price. Pioli’s side have blanked their opponents in three of their last five home games, all of which were won.
